开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> java将pdf流转为图片_Java实现PDF流转为图片的方法
默认会员免费送
帮助中心 >

java将pdf流转为图片_Java实现PDF流转为图片的方法

2024-12-30 16:05:24
java将pdf流转为图片_java实现pdf流转为图片的方法
《java将pdf流转为图片》

在java中,我们可以借助一些库来实现将pdf流转换为图片。例如,itext和apache pdfbox。

使用apache pdfbox时,首先需要导入相关的库文件。通过加载pdf文档的字节流,然后逐页将其转换为图片。可以指定图像的格式,如png、jpeg等。它会解析pdf的内容结构,把每一页按照设定的分辨率转换为对应的图片。这一功能在很多场景下都非常有用,比如需要对pdf中的页面进行预览展示,或者从pdf中提取特定页面的图像信息进行进一步处理,极大地提高了文档处理的灵活性和效率。

pdf转图片java最快

pdf转图片java最快
# java中快速实现pdf转图片

在java开发中,要实现pdf转图片且追求速度,可以使用apache pdfbox库。

首先,在项目中引入pdfbox依赖。示例代码如下:

```java
import org.apache.pdfbox.pdmodel.pddocument;
import org.apache.pdfbox.rendering.imagetype;
import org.apache.pdfbox.rendering.pdfrenderer;

import javax.imageio.imageio;
import java.awt.image.bufferedimage;
import java.io.file;
import java.io.ioexception;

public class pdftoimage {
public static void main(string[] args) throws ioexception {
pddocument document = pddocument.load(new file("input.pdf"));
pdfrenderer renderer = new pdfrenderer(document);
for (int page = 0; page < document.getnumberofpages(); page++) {
bufferedimage image = renderer.renderimagewithdpi(page, 300, imagetype.rgb);
file outputfile = new file("page" + (page + 1) + ".png");
imageio.write(image, "png", outputfile);
}
document.close();
}
}


```

pdfbox提供了高效的pdf解析和渲染功能。通过`pdfrenderer`可以将pdf的每一页转换为`bufferedimage`,然后利用`imageio`保存为图片,在实际应用中能快速满足pdf转图片的需求。

java把pdf转图片

java把pdf转图片
## 《java实现pdf转图片》

在java中,将pdf转换为图片是一个常见需求。我们可以借助一些开源库来实现,例如apache pdfbox。

首先,需要在项目中引入pdfbox库。然后,通过以下基本步骤进行转换:加载pdf文档,使用`pddocument.load()`方法传入pdf文件路径。接着,获取文档的每一页内容,利用`pdfrenderer`来渲染每一页为`bufferedimage`。最后,将`bufferedimage`保存为图片文件,可以选择常见的图片格式如png、jpeg等,通过`imageio.write()`方法实现。

这样,通过java程序就能方便地将pdf文件转换为一张张的图片,在文档处理、电子资源展示等场景中有很大的实用价值。

java pdf转png

java pdf转png
《java实现pdf转png》

在java中,我们可以借助一些开源库来实现将pdf转换为png图像。其中,apache pdfbox是一个常用的选择。

首先,需要在项目中引入pdfbox的相关依赖。然后,通过加载pdf文档对象,获取到每一页内容。对于每一页,可以创建一个图像对象,指定png的格式,并根据页面尺寸等设置图像的属性。利用pdfbox的渲染功能,将pdf页面内容渲染到图像对象上,最后保存为png文件。

这种转换在很多场景下非常有用,例如文档预览功能需要将pdf以图片形式展示,或者是进行图像化的文档处理。java的强大库支持使得pdf转png变得高效、可行。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信